Statistical Overview

A deep dive into the statistics reveals intriguing insights into the dynamics of their rivalry. While Djokovic may have a marginal advantage in overall wins, Nadal dominates on clay, his preferred surface. This disparity underscores Nadal's unparalleled dominance at the French Open, where he has reigned supreme for over a decade. Conversely, Djokovic has had more success on hard courts, where his aggressive baseline game and exceptional return of serve give him an edge. Their matches on grass courts, particularly at Wimbledon, have been relatively balanced, with both players showcasing their adaptability and skill on the slick surface. Analyzing these statistical trends provides a nuanced understanding of the ebbs and flows of their rivalry, highlighting the importance of surface conditions and individual strengths.

Australian Open Final (2012)

The 2012 Australian Open final is widely regarded as one of the greatest tennis matches of all time. Lasting nearly six hours, this epic encounter tested the physical and mental limits of both players. Nadal and Djokovic traded blows from the baseline, engaging in relentless rallies that pushed each other to the brink of exhaustion. The match was filled with dramatic twists and turns, with both players squandering match points before Djokovic finally emerged victorious in the fifth set. The sheer intensity and duration of the match cemented its place in tennis history, showcasing the unwavering determination and resilience of Nadal and Djokovic.

Nadal's Strengths

Nadal's strengths lie in his unparalleled athleticism, his devastating forehand, and his unwavering mental toughness. He is one of the fittest players on the tour, capable of running down seemingly impossible shots and maintaining his intensity throughout long matches. His forehand is a weapon of mass destruction, generating incredible topspin and power that can overwhelm his opponents. Nadal's mental toughness is legendary, allowing him to overcome adversity and perform at his best under pressure. These strengths have made him one of the most dominant players in the history of tennis, particularly on clay.

Djokovic's Strengths

Djokovic's strengths lie in his exceptional court coverage, his incredible return of serve, and his tactical brilliance. He is one of the most agile and flexible players on the tour, capable of reaching shots that others cannot. His return of serve is arguably the best in the game, allowing him to neutralize his opponent's serve and put them on the defensive. Djokovic's tactical brilliance is evident in his ability to analyze his opponent's weaknesses and exploit them with precision. These strengths have made him a formidable opponent on all surfaces, particularly on hard courts.
